Stoner plays down pole record

Casey Stoner says he does not think his record-equalling tally of 12 pole positions in a premier class season this year should be compared to Mick Doohan's benchmark 12-pole tally from the 1997 500cc world championship. Champion rider Stoner claimed his 12th pole of the year at Valencia today to draw level with Doohan's mark, in a year when no one else has taken more than two poles. But Stoner, who has also won nine races this season, insisted that as the 2011 MotoGP calendar featured 18 rounds and Doohan scored his 12 poles within 15 races, comparisons were inappropriate
